Bachelor of Engineering (Hons) / Bachelor of Science (Hons) Scheme in Information and Artificial Intelligence Engineering

Subject Syllabi
EIE1D02 |
Electronic Music: The Impact of Technology on Digital Lifestyle (View the Introductory Video here) |
EIE1D03 | Artificial Intelligence and Science Fiction |
EIE1D04 | Cyber Security Essentials |
EIE1005 | Fundamental AI and Data Analytics |
EIE2S02 | Promoting Digital Literacy in Developing Societies |
EIE1005 | Fundamental AI and Data Analytics |
Undergraduate Programme Subjects | |
EIE1003 | Foundations of Data Science |
EIE1004 | Introduction to Information and Artificial Intelligence Engineering |
EIE2100 | Basic Circuit Analysis |
EIE2101 | Basic Circuit Analysis |
EIE2102 | Basic Electronics |
EIE2105 | Digital and Computer Systems |
EIE2108 | Fundamentals of Internet and Multimedia Technologies |
EIE2110 | Basic Circuit Analysis and Electronics |
EIE2111 | Computer Programming |
EIE2112 | Foundation Techniques in Artificial Intelligence |
EIE2113 | Introduction to Internet of Things |
EIE2211 | Logic Design |
EIE2261 | Logic Design |
EIE2282 | Information Technology |
EIE2302 | Electricity and Electronics |
EIE2901/IC2114 | Industrial Centre Training I for EIE |
EIE2902/IC2115 | Industrial Centre Training for EIE |
EIE2903/IC2140 | Practical Training |
EIE3100 | Analogue Circuit Fundamentals |
EIE3101 |
Computer Animation (View the Introductory Video here) |
EIE3103 | Digital Signals and Systems |
EIE3105 | Integrated Project |
EIE3106 | Integrated Project |
EIE3109 | Mobile Systems and Application Development |
EIE3112 | Database System |
EIE3117 | Integrated Project |
EIE3120 | Network Technologies and Security |
EIE3123 | Dynamic Electronic Systems |
EIE3124 | Fundamentals of Machine Intelligence |
EIE3127 | Artificial Intelligence of Things |
EIE3128 | IoT Project |
EIE3129 | IoT Security |
EIE3130 | Network Security |
EIE3305 | Integrated Analogue and Digital Circuits |
EIE3311 | Computer System Fundamentals |
EIE3312 | Linear Systems |
EIE3320 |
Object-Oriented Design and Programming (View the Introductory Video here) |
EIE3331 | Communication Fundamentals |
EIE3333 | Data and Computer Communications |
EIE3343 | Computer Systems Principles |
EIE3360 | Integrated Project |
EIE3373 | Microcontroller Systems and Interface |
EIE3901/IC382 | Multidisciplinary Manufacturing Project |
EIE4100 | Computer Vision and Pattern Recognition |
EIE4102 | IP Networks |
EIE4104 | Mobile Networking |
EIE4105 | Multimodal Human Computer Interaction Technology |
EIE4106 | Network Management and Security (View the Introductory Video here) |
Distributed Systems and Cloud Computing (View the Introductory Video here) |
|
EIE4110 | Introduction to VLSI and Computer-Aided Circuit Design |
EIE4113 | Wireless and Mobile Systems |
EIE4114 | Digital Forensics for Crime Investigation |
EIE4116 | Surveillance Studies and Technologies |
EIE4117 | Capstone Project |
Intrusion Detection and Penetration Test (View the Introductory Video here) |
|
EIE4119 |
Mobile Device System Architecture (View the Introductory Video here) |
EIE4121 | Machine Learning in Cyber-security |
EIE4122 |
Deep Learning and Deep Neural Networks (View the Introductory Video here) |
EIE4123 |
Healthcare Technology |
EIE4124 |
Modern Robotics |
EIE4125 |
Power Conversion Technology for Energy Harvesting |
EIE4126 |
Capstone Project |
EIE4127 |
Capstone Project |
Power Electronics (View the Introductory Video here) |
|
EIE4413 | Digital Signal Processing (View the Introductory Video here) |
EIE4428 | Multimedia Communications |
EIE4430 | Honours Project |
EIE4431 | Digital Video Production and Broadcasting |
EIE4432 |
Web Systems and Technologies (View the Introductory Video here) |
EIE4433 | Honours Project |
EIE4435 | Image and Audio Processing |
Optical Communication Systems and Networks (View the Introductory Video here) |
MSc Subjects | |
Satellite Communications - Technology and Applications (View the Introductory Video here) |
|
EIE511 | VLSI System Design |
EIE515 | Advanced Optical Communication Systems |
EIE522 | Pattern Recognition: Theory & Applications |
EIE529 | Digital Image Processing |
Video Technology (View the Introductory Video here) |
|
EIE553 | Security in Data Communication (View the Introductory Video here) |
EIE557 | Computational Intelligence and its Applications |
Speech Processing and Recognition (View the Introductory Video here) |
|
EIE560 |
Microelectronics Processing and Technologies |
EIE563 | Digital Audio Processing |
EIE566 | Wireless Communications |
Wireless Power Transfer Technologies (View the Introductory Video here) |
|
IoT - Tools and Applications (View the Introductory Video here) |
|
Sensor Networks (View the Introductory Video here) |
|
EIE570 |
Deep Learning with Photonics |
EIE571 |
Photonic System Analysis |
EIE572 |
Information Photonics |
EIE573 |
Mobile Edge Computing |
EIE575 | Vehicular Communications and Inter-Networking Technologies (View the Introductory Video here) |
EIE577 | Optoelectronic Devices |
EIE579 | Advanced Telecommunication Systems |
EIE580 | RF and Microwave Integrated Circuits for Communication System Applications |
Channel Coding (View the Introductory Video here) |
|
EIE589 | Wireless Data Network |
MPhil/PhD Subjects | |
EIE6200 | Methodology for Engineering and Scientific Research |
EIE6207 | Theoretical Fundamental and Engineering Approaches for Intelligent Signal and Information Processing |
EIE6811-EIE6813 | Guided Study in Electronic and Information Engineering I/II/III |
EIE621-EIE623 | Special Topics in Electronic and Information Engineering I/II/III |
Note: The subject syllabi contained in this website are subject to review and changes from time to time. The Department of Electronic and Information Engineering reserves the right to revise or withdraw the offer of any subject contained in this website.